In the rapidly evolving tech landscape, Qualcomm (Nasdaq: QCOM) is positioning itself as a pioneer in quantum communications, a sphere that promises to revolutionize data transmission. Known for its prowess in mobile chipsets, Qualcomm is now shifting focus towards integrating quantum technologies with its existing platforms, an ambitious endeavor aimed at future-proofing its portfolio.
With the exponentially rising demand for faster and more secure data processing, the limitations of traditional computing are becoming increasingly apparent. Qualcomm’s recent announcement of its investment in quantum communication research seeks to address this challenge. By exploring quantum encryption and secure data transfer, Qualcomm aims to significantly enhance the security and speed of wireless communications, a critical factor as we move towards 6G networks.
The transition from classical to quantum communication systems could potentially redefine cybersecurity, offering a virtually unhackable method of securing information. Qualcomm’s exploration into creating a hybrid model—combining classical semiconductor technology with quantum computing principles—indicates a strategic move to remain at the forefront of technological innovation.
Investors and tech enthusiasts are closely monitoring Qualcomm’s advancements, speculating that this could pave the way for breakthroughs in sectors ranging from finance to healthcare. What Are the Benefits and Limitations of Quantum Communication for Qualcomm?
Pros:
– Enhanced Security: Quantum encryption is expected to offer near unbreakable security, a crucial advancement for protecting sensitive data.
– Speed Improvements: Quantum communication technologies could enable faster data transmission rates.
– Innovation Leadership: By being at the forefront of quantum technology integration, Qualcomm can position itself as a pioneer in the field.
Cons:
– High Costs: Research and development in quantum technology require substantial investment.
– Implementation Challenges: Integrating quantum systems with existing infrastructures may pose significant technical hurdles.
– Long-Term Uncertainty: The practical applications of quantum communications are still largely theoretical and not widely tested.
